A Novel Smartphone App for Self-Monitoring of Neonatal Jaundice Among Postpartum Mothers: Qualitative Research Study

Abstract BackgroundNeonatal jaundice (NNJ) or hyperbilirubinemia is a ubiquitous condition in newborn infants.
